Austin wifi

Austin's a great place for wifi -- I remember driving past the Dairy Queen on Burnet once and noting that the marquis advertised free wifi. Now it's even better, with a big chunk of East Austin covered:

“The expansion of the Austin Outdoor Wireless Mesh Project is yet another example of using technology to improve the quality of life for our residents,” said Mayor Will Wynn. “This outdoor wireless network will provide a benefit to our citizens by providing greater access to the Internet and to our city by helping to attract and retain businesses and promote tourism.”
